Mental Suffering
The Cyclopedic Law Dictionary · Walter A. Shumaker and George Foster Longsdorf; ed. James C. Cahill · 1922
The Cyclopedic Law Dictionary
A mental emotion arising from a physical injury; any mental anguish cannected with bodily injury.
Braun v. Craven, 175 111. 408; Tomasi V. Donk Bros. Coal Co., 257 111. 75.
